
Senior/Lead Python Data Engineer
Newfire Global Partners
full-time
Posted on:
Location Type: Remote
Location: United States
Visit company websiteExplore more
Job Level
About the role
- Design, build, and maintain production Python data pipelines, working daily with Python, Dagster, Snowflake, and Databricks
- Define, evolve, and document Python engineering standards, patterns, and guardrails for the data platform
- Lead adoption of version-locked dependency management and standardized development workflows
- Build, maintain, and improve GitHub Actions CI/CD pipelines for build, test, security checks, and deployment
- Review complex designs and code for correctness, security, performance, and long-term maintainability
- Ensure data pipelines are reliable and operable, with proper error handling, retries, idempotency, and validation
- Anticipate failure modes and design systems for recoverability and operational clarity
- Troubleshoot CI/CD failures, dependency conflicts, and production incidents, participating in root-cause analysis
- Apply secure development practices appropriate for healthcare data (secrets management, least privilege, safe logging)
- Collaborate closely with platform architecture and data platform teams to ensure end-to-end coherence
- Mentor senior engineers through design reviews, technical guidance, and knowledge sharing
- As a Senior team member, you will be expected to actively participate in our hiring processes by serving on interview panels for future roles across the company.
Requirements
- 8+ years of experience in data engineering or backend platform roles, with deep hands-on Python expertise
- Strong experience designing and operating modern data platforms, working daily with Python, Dagster, Snowflake, and/or Databricks
- Proven ability to define and enforce engineering standards, patterns, and guardrails
- Experience leading technical decision-making on high-impact or long-term architectural changes
- Strong understanding of CI/CD, dependency management, testing, and release practices for Python systems
- Hands-on experience with GitHub and GitHub Actions for CI/CD
- Solid knowledge of data modeling, orchestration, and workflow design
- Experience working in regulated environments, preferably healthcare
- Awareness of HIPAA / HITRUST requirements when handling sensitive data
- Strong troubleshooting skills and an ownership mindset for production systems
- Experience with SSIS is a strong plus
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
PythonDagsterSnowflakeDatabricksCI/CDdependency managementdata modelingorchestrationworkflow designSSIS
Soft Skills
leadershipmentoringtroubleshootingcollaborationtechnical decision-makingknowledge sharingownership mindset
Certifications
HIPAAHITRUST